The medical device manufacturing sector is witnessing a wave of innovation driven by technological advancements and evolving market needs. This article outlines key trends in manufacturing that are shaping the future of medical device exports.
Automation and robotics are revolutionizing how medical devices are produced. These technologies not only increase efficiency but also enhance precision in manufacturing, crucial for compliance with stringent regulatory standards.
3D printing has emerged as a game changer for manufacturing customized medical devices. This technology allows for the rapid prototyping of products, reducing time-to-market and enabling manufacturers to respond quickly to market demands.
As the global emphasis on sustainability grows, manufacturers must adopt eco-friendly practices. Utilizing recyclable materials and minimizing waste not only benefits the environment but also appeals to a more conscious consumer base.
The integration of IoT in medical devices is enhancing product capabilities. Devices can now track usage data, enabling manufacturers to refine their designs based on real-world feedback.
Innovation in medical device manufacturing is critical for companies looking to enhance their export potential. By embracing new technologies and sustainable practices, manufacturers can ensure their products meet the demands of a global market.
